What is CVE-2025-32521?
A reflected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in the CoolHappy Cool Flipbox – Shortcode & Gutenberg Block. This vulnerability allows attackers to inject malicious scripts into web pages viewed by other users. When exploited, the vulnerability can result in unauthorized actions being performed on behalf of the user, leading to potential data theft or other harmful consequences. Affected versions are all prior to 1.8.3, necessitating an urgent update to mitigate risks and enhance web application security.
